STEM Facilitation PD
This session introduces STEM Facilitators to PEAR’s Dimensions of Success (DoS) tool—a research-based framework that highlights best practices for delivering high-quality STEM experiences. Participants will explore the twelve dimensions that define effective STEM programming, engage in hands-on practice using the tool, and reflect on how to apply these insights to their own settings. Through real-world examples and collaborative activities, attendees will gain a clearer picture of what quality looks like in informal STEM learning. You'll leave with a practical resource to support continuous improvement and elevate the impact of your programming across any offering.
